Output d00888e75de97231b6c2c7025fb55d0ed8afeee876c68a29b23593b40f46bf32:0

value
28083811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c5c0603af08f788f40371f6600a219e53fe831f OP_EQUAL
address
35jZttVw8TJNyQtw2G9DQMgTyZLWGPT38v
transaction
d00888e75de97231b6c2c7025fb55d0ed8afeee876c68a29b23593b40f46bf32
confirmations
457898
spent
true